Abstract: A method of configuring a measurement for a mobile terminal configured with a plurality of component carriers in a wireless communication system is discussed. The method is performed by a base station and includes transmitting, by the base station, configuration information to the mobile terminal. Further, when the transmitted configuration information includes an indication information for the measurement in an extension component carrier among the plurality of component carriers, the measurement in the extension component carrier is based on a channel state information reference signal (CSI-RS), and when the transmitted configuration information does not include the indication information for the measurement in the extension component carrier among the plurality of component carriers, the measurement in the extension component carrier is based on a cell specific reference signal (CRS).

Abstract: The present invention relates to a wireless communication system. In more detail, in relation to a method for a terminal to transmit ACK/NACK in a wireless communication system, an ACK/NACK transmission method includes: receiving at least one Physical Downlink Shared Channel (PDSCH); transmitting at least one ACK/NACK corresponding to the at least one PDSCH through a plurality of Physical Uplink Control Channel (PUCCH) formats; and, when the at least one ACK/NACK is transmitted using a first PUCCH format, transmitting at least one ACK/NACK in an antenna port transmission mode set for a second PUCCH format.

Abstract: Provided are a method and apparatus for requesting scheduling for an uplink data transmission in a wireless communication system. The method may include receiving, by a user equipment, an additional scheduling request (SR) resource configuration information including additional SR resource information and buffer size information configured to the additional SR resource in addition to a default SR resource from a base station, transmitting, by the user equipment, an SR through the default SR resource or the additional SR resource to the base station, receiving, by the user equipment, an uplink resource allocation information which is determined according to the resource in which the SR is transmitted from the base station, and transmitting, by the user equipment, the uplink data to the base station through a physical uplink shared channel (PUSCH) resource which is allocated by the uplink resource allocation information.

Abstract: A method for transmitting and receiving data in a wireless communication system and an apparatus for the method are disclosed. More specifically, The present invention provides a method for transmitting downlink data in a wireless communication system can comprise mapping, by a eNB, first downlink data into a physical downlink shared channel (PDSCH) region according to a radio frame structure based on a first transmission time interval (TTI), mapping, by the eNB, second downlink data to a short PDSCH (sPDSCH) region according to a radio frame structure based on a second TTI, and transmitting, by the eNB, the first and the second downlink data.

Abstract: The present invention provides a method for hybrid scanning to reduce overhead in a beam scanning scheme in a millimeter wave (mmWave) system, and devices supporting same. The method for hybrid scanning in a wireless access system supporting millimeter wave technology, according to one embodiment of the present invention, comprises the steps of: receiving a synchronization signal to synchronize with a base station; synchronizing with the base station using the synchronization signal; receiving, from the base station, first pilot signals having different configuration patterns according to each transmitting antenna; ray-scanning using the first pilot signals; selecting a candidate beamforming port set through the ray-scanning; generating second pilot signals having different configuration patterns according to each beamforming port included in the candidate beamforming port set; and transmitting, to the base station, the second pilot signals to perform beam scanning with the base station.

Abstract: The present invention relates to a wireless communication system and, more specifically, to a method and an apparatus for reporting channel status information (CSI). Particularly, the method by which a terminal in the wireless communication system reports the CSI, comprises the steps of: receiving a reference signal from a base station; and reporting, to the base station, the CSI generated by using the reference signal, wherein the CSI includes channel information for a plurality of antenna ports mapped according to a first parameter, and the first parameter is a value related to vertical domain antenna ports indicated through upper layer signaling.

Abstract: The present invention relates to a method for positioning multiple user equipments (UEs) by a base station in a wireless communication system supporting full-duplex communication and an apparatus therefor. More specifically, the present invention comprises: setting a unit distance on the basis of the magnitude of inter-device interference (IDI) with respect to a first UE; and establishing multiple boundaries around each of the multiple UEs and the base station according to relative distances on the basis of the unit distance and checking whether the boundaries overlap each other. Here, the relative distances indicate with respect to the multiple UEs, measured on the basis of the magnitude of inter-device interference (IDI).

Abstract: A method for monitoring a downlink control channel in a wireless communication system and an apparatus for the method are disclosed. More specifically, a method for monitoring a downlink control channel of a user equipment (UE) in a wireless communication system comprises receiving, by the UE, configuration information of a first discontinuous reception (DRX) mode based on a first transmission time interval (TTI) and configuration information of a second DRX mode based on a second TTI from an evolved-NodeB (eNB); and monitoring, by the UE, a first downlink control channel in a first DRX listening interval within a first DRX cycle based on the configuration information of the first DRX mode and a second downlink control channel in a second DRX listening interval within a second DRX cycle based on the configuration information of the second DRX mode, wherein the second DRX cycle is set to be shorter than the first DRX cycle.

Abstract: The present invention relates to a wireless communication system. The present invention relates to a method for transmitting ACK/NACK in a wireless communication system in which carrier aggregation is set, and an apparatus therefor. Specifically, the present invention relates to an ACK/NACK transmission method and an apparatus therefor, the method comprising the steps of: receiving information on a plurality of physical uplink control channel (PUCCH) resources via upper layer signaling; receiving a transmit power control (TPC) field on a secondary carrier through a physical downlink control channel (PDCCH); receiving data indicated by the PDCCH; and transmitting ACK/NACK for the data, wherein the ACK/NACK is transmitted using a PUCCH resource which is indicated by the value of the TPC field among the plurality of PUCCH resources.

Abstract: According to one embodiment of the present invention, a method by which a fixed base station adjusts inter-cell interference in a wireless communication system comprises the steps of: receiving channel state information-reference signal (CSI-RS) configurations on an access link of each moving cell connected to the fixed base station; determining the CSI-RS configuration on a backhaul link of a first moving cell among the moving cells on the basis of the CSI-RS configurations on the access link; and providing, to the first moving cell, the CSI-RS configuration on the determined backhaul link, wherein the CSI-RS configuration on the determined backhaul link is for measuring, by the backhaul link of the first moving cell, the interference received from an access link of a second moving cell among the moving cells.
